1.1 Background to the Study

Industrial sector plays a crucial role in the development of modern economy the world over. Industrial sector as a sub-sector of the industrial sector refers to the productions of goods and services through combined utilization of raw materials and other production factors such as labor force, land and capital or by means of production process. In advanced economies, the industrial sector is a leading sector in many respects. It is an avenue for increasing productivity related to import replacement and export expansion, creating foreign exchange earning capacity; and raising employment and per capita income which causes unique consumption patterns. Furthermore, it creates investment capital at a faster rate than any other sector of the economy while promoting wider and more effective linkages among different sectors. In terms of contribution to the Gross Domestic Product (GDP), the manufacturing sector is dominant and it has been overtaken the services sector in a number of Organization for Economic Co-operation and development (OECD) countries (Anyanwu, 2010).

In recognition of these potential roles of the sector, successive governments in Nigeria have continued to articulate policy measures and programmes to achieve industrial growth incentive and adequate finance (Orji, 2012). To underscore the pivotal and critical role the manufacturing industry plays in capital formation, domestic savings and its effect in the realization of sustainable economic growth and general prosperity in Nigeria, the federal government at different times introduced a number of schemes such as World Bank SME II Loan

Scheme (1987), Small Scale Industries Credit Scheme (1971), established Industrial Development Centres, National Economic Reconstruction Fund( NERFUND), Nigerian Bank for Commerce and Industries, Nigerian Industrial Development Bank all aimed at improving and sustaining the performance of the sector. In 2010, the federal government through the Central Bank of Nigeria made available the sum of =N=200 billion as Manufacturers’ Intervention Fund. “The objectives of the fund include fast-tracking the development of the manufacturing sector of the Nigerian economy by improving access to credit to manufacturers; improving the financial position of the Deposit Money Banks; increasing output; generating employment; diversifying the revenue base, as well as increasing foreign exchange earnings. It is also meant to provide inputs for the industrial sector on a sustainable basis.”(CBN, 2010). Similarly, the involvement of the private sector such as the Dangote group, Honey well among others in the manufacturing sector has boosted its development.

The post-independence Nigerian government adopted the entrepreneurship government which constrained it to assume the role of entrepreneur and the urge to offset the economic neglect of the colonial government and that resulted in engaging in ambitious industrialization programmes. When the Nigerian industrial Development Bank Limited (NIDB) was established in 1964 for the purpose of speeding up the industrialization process, its mandate was to promote industrial projects which were large enough to make applicable contribution to the national economy. However, the collapse of the oil boom in the early 1980’s exposed the inherent weaknesses of this importation of inputs resulted in large idle capacities, thereby creeping many gross domestic product (GDP) declined in the face of the strong national aspiration for the restructuring of the economy and reduction of the dependence on petroleum.

Small and medium scale enterprises have since become the focus of national industrial policy. 1.2 Statement Of The Problem

The industrial sector in Nigeria is faced with the problem of accessibility of funds for productive investment, hence its poor performance in recent years (Edirisuriya, 2008). It is against this Background that this paper intends to investigate the effects of deposit money bank credit on the manufacturing sector in Nigeria. Also, given the present government’s policy twist of diversifying the economy away from oil towards non oil in which manufacturing sector is central on one hand, and on the other hand increasing the rates of interest on loans as signaled by the recent hike in the MPR from 12 to 14, calls for the investigation of the effect of bank credit which is largely determined by the prevailing interest rate on the manufacturing sector output in Nigeria.

In an attempt to modernize many small scale enterprises, their standard of operation has moved into the capital intensive stage. The need in many cases is beyond the financial capability of the entrepreneurs who set up the business. The major alternative for the provision of such capital is the financial institutions and among the financial institutions operating in the country, commercial banks are the major sources of credit to the various sectors of the economy.

However, it is common knowledge that getting financial support from commercial banks has been grossly inadequate for budding indigenous entrepreneurs and even for those who have been in the manufacturing business for a long term. Therefore this research work investigates commercial banks and industrial development in Nigeria: Issues and analysis within the sample period of 1980-2015.
